חצי קדיש

HALF KADDISH

After the Reading of the Torah, the Reader says Half Kaddish:
Reader:
Hebrew
יִתְגַּדַּל וְיִתְקַדַּשׁ שְׁמֵהּ רַבָּא (קהל: אָמֵן)
בְּעָלְמָא דִּי בְרָא כִרְעוּתֵהּ
וְיַמְלִיךְ מַלְכוּתֵהּ
וְיַצְמַח פֻּרְקָנֵהּ וִיקָרֵב מְשִׁיחֵהּ (קהל: אָמֵן)
בְּחַיֵּיכוֹן וּבְיוֹמֵיכוֹן וּבְחַיֵּי דְכָל בֵּית יִשְׂרָאֵל
בַּעֲגָלָא וּבִזְמַן קָרִיב, וְאִמְרוּ אָמֵן. (קהל: אָמֵן)
Sephardi
Yitgadal veyitkadash shemeh raba (kahal: Amen)
be'alma di vera chir'uteh
veyamlich malchuteh
veyatzmach purkaneih vikarev meshicheh (kahal: Amen)
bechayeichon uveyomeichon uvechayei dechol beit Yisrael
ba'agala uvizman kariv, ve'imru Amen. (kahal: Amen)
English
Magnified and sanctified may His great name be, in the world He created by His will. May He establish His kingdom, make His salvation flourish, and hasten His messiah, in your lifetime and in your days, and in the lifetime of all the house of Israel, swiftly and soon – and say: Amen.
All:
Hebrew
יְהֵא שְׁמֵהּ רַבָּא מְבָרַךְ לְעָלַם וּלְעָלְמֵי עָלְמַיָּא.
Sephardi
Yehei shemeh raba mevarach le'alam ul'almei almaya.
English
May His great name be blessed for ever and all time.

The Torah scroll is lifted and the congregation says:
Deut. 4Num. 9
Hebrew
וְזֹאת הַתּוֹרָה אֲשֶׁר־שָׂם מֹשֶׁה לִפְנֵי בְּנֵי יִשְׂרָאֵל:
עַל־פִּי יהוה בְּיַד־מֹשֶׁה:
Sephardi
Vezot haTorah asher-sam Moshe lifnei benei Yisrael:
al-pi Adonai beyad-Moshe:
English
This is the Torah that Moses placed before the children of Israel, at the LORD's commandment, by the hand of Moses.
